So there I was on a exploring the new homestead and noticed I needed to tie up a boot... I found a dead log and bent over to tie it up and saw this right underneath me.

I'm pretty sure I let out a fear fart as I jumped off the log at the speed of light. Seriously, I thought I was finally the person who discovered a real Bigfoot's foot. After carfully looking over top of the log to make sure no bigfoot was behind it. I got curious and poked it with a stick. Then I noticed that it hooked onto a stem that goes into the ground. Odd... so I pulled out my phone and googled "foot plant mushroom" and there it was... "dead mans finger toes fungi". :barnie
